Job Title: Epidemiologist – Intermediate Level Location: Hybrid (Remote with occasional office visits 1–2 times/month) Work Schedule: 5 days per week (remote), occasional travel to other counties or conferences reimbursed for mileage Job Summary: This position serves as an intermediate-level professional epidemiologist, responsible for conducting a complex range of investigative and analytical epidemiologic activities related to surveillance, detection, and prevention of diseases and injuries. The candidate will work independently or as part of a team, providing epidemiologic expertise for programs or complex analyses under the direction of senior staff.
